International cooperation on AIDS prevention to be enhanced: vice-premier

Chinese Vice-Premier Wu Yi said in Beijing on May 24 that China will enhance international cooperation on the prevention and treatment of AIDS to protect the health and lives of Chinese people.

Wu made the remark when meeting with Peter Piot, executive director of UNAIDS (Joint United Nations Program on HIV/AIDS).

She said the Chinese government has always attached great importance to the cooperation with UNAIDS and China hopes the spread of AIDS in the world will be effectively contained with the active efforts of UNAIDS.

Wu also briefed Piot on China's anti-AIDS efforts and the challenges the country faces in curbing AIDS.

She said the Chinese government will continue making active efforts in supporting UNAIDS' global anti-AIDS strategy and improve international exchange and cooperation to curb the spread of AIDS in China and protect the health and life security of the general public.

Piot said he appreciated the Chinese government's attitude and efforts in fighting against AIDS and UNAIDS will, as always, give its full support to China's efforts in the prevention and treatment of AIDS.
